American actor Mark Ruffalo has urged world leaders to intervene in Gaza Strip, describing the worsening humanitarian crisis as a man-made famine and a crime against humanity.

Taking to Instagram, he posted a video of himself addressing the crisis and citing findings from the Integrated Food Security Phase Classification (IPC), the international body responsible for declaring famine conditions, which confirmed that Gaza has entered a state of famine. "This is not a natural disaster. It's not a drought. It's a man-made disaster, a man-made criminal act to kill civilian populations.
